723.04 LICENSE EXPIRATION; REVOCATION.
   (a)   All licenses issued pursuant to this article shall expire on July 31 of each year.
 
   (b)   Any license or renewal thereof issued pursuant to this chapter may be revoked by the City Manager or his designee, after reasonable notice and opportunity to be heard, for any violation of this chapter, by the licensee or by any of his officers, agents or employees. Whenever a license has been revoked under this section, the City Manager or his designee shall not issue another license to such licensee, to the husband or wife of such licensee or to any partnership or corporation of which he is an officer or member, until the expiration of at least one year from the date of revocation of such license.
